Considered to be one of Agatha Christie's most controversial mysteries, The Murder of Roger Ackroyd breaks all the rules of traditional mystery writing.
First published in 1926, it is said to be one of her best novels. It is one of 66 detective novels and 14 short story collections. Agatha was born in 1890 but has written stories that have stood the test of time
